What is a Vacuum Robot with Self-Emptying?

A vacuum robot with self-emptying functionality is created to autonomously clean your floorings while likewise emptying its dustbin into a base station, eliminating the requirement for frequent manual intervention. These advanced designs are geared up with a vacuum chamber that can keep considerable quantities of dirt and particles, allowing users to go weeks and even months in between upkeep.

How Do Self-Emptying Vacuum Robots Work?

The operation of self-emptying vacuum robots can be broken down into a series of steps:

  1. Cleaning Session Initiation: When set to begin cleaning, the vacuum robot navigates through the home, preventing obstacles while drawing up dirt and debris.

  2. Go back to Base: Once cleaning is complete or its battery runs low, the robot returns to its base station.

  3. Self-Emptying Mechanism: Using suction power, the vacuum robot transfers gathered debris from its little dustbin into the bigger dust receptacle situated in the docking station.

  4. Tracking: Some sophisticated designs include app combination that enables users to keep track of the vacuum’s cleaning history and get notifies when trash requires to be dealt with from the base station.

Things to Consider When Buying a Self-Emptying Vacuum Robot

While the benefit of a self-emptying vacuum robot is engaging, here are key factors to consider:

1. Suction Power

Examine the suction power, especially if you have family pets or reside in a high-traffic location. The stronger the suction, the better the robot will clean.

2. Size of Dustbin and Base

Review the storage capability of the self-emptying base, as this figures out how often you need to change the collection bag or empty the base.

3. Smart Features

Look for designs with smart mapping innovation, which permits the vacuum to successfully find out the layout of your home and clean efficiently.

4. Battery Life

Think about for how long the vacuum can clean up on a single charge. Models that return to their base to charge and resume cleaning are particularly helpful.

5. Filter Quality

High-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ters are crucial for capturing irritants and guaranteeing cleaner air in your house.

6. Noise Level

Robotic vacuums can be noisy, so checking out reviews regarding their functional sound levels can assist you pick a quieter design.
